Indian stock markets are expected to open flat, mirroring weak global sentiment as US indices declined for the fourth consecutive day. The Gift Nifty indicated a tepid start. On November 18, the Sensex and Nifty 50 closed lower, ending a six-day rally. Domestic Institutional Investors (DIIs) were net buyers, while Foreign Institutional Investors (FIIs) were net sellers. Key company developments include KP Energy's wind project MoU, an IT firm's expanded Microsoft collaboration, GAIL's restored CNG supply, and NTPC's solar project commissioning.
